Internal memo — quarterly stock-count ledger transfer. To the receiving site at Ashdell Works: the Q3 stock-count ledger for the Penrook warehouse has been finalised and signed off by the counting team. It will travel by bonded courier on Thursday rather than by internal post, given the audit flags raised last quarter. Please log the arrival in the goods-in register and keep the ledger in the locked cabinet until the auditors visit. Your receiving clerk should follow the hand-over instruction given below.

handover note for tafog-bawef: the ulair kasael courier leaves the ralok gilmir fenael druwyn feneth queniel belix keliel ledger at gate 5216 under passcode 961436

// Heads up, reviewer: this constant caps how many profile shards
// the Fernwick directory service will fan out to per lookup. We
// bumped it from 8 to 16 after the Q3 resharding, and yes, the
// hash salt rotates with each shard epoch, so no cross-shard
// correlation is possible. If you want to verify this yourself,
// the build it shipped in is pinned right below.

build token for kagaf-hahof: htk14_9d3d4d26d7d8de

Subject: DR drill — rotatekit recovery step

Team, during yesterday's disaster-recovery drill we exercised the full restore path for rotatekit, our internal secrets-rotation utility at Fennelgate Systems. The rotation schedule, vault bindings, and operator roles all restored correctly from the cold snapshot. For future maintainers: the last manual step is re-arming the master keyring, which requires the escrowed recovery passphrase. Per drill procedure, the duty officer transcribes it here immediately after sign-off.

recovery phrase for bawep-kawef: oliath-casdor